About Me

Brigitte DeHaven
Music, math, language arts, and teaching have been my life for decades. I sang in church and at local events from the time I could talk. I began piano lessons at age six, and have taught piano, served as pianist/organist, and directed adult and children’s choirs since I was a teen! I have performed in bands (concert, jazz, marching), choirs (concert, gospel, show), and dinner theatre.

With a BA in math education and music education, I taught math and language arts for several years, from elementary to high school, in public and private schools. I homeschooled our daughter up to 3rd grade. In 2010 I created an annual Poetry Panel program at a private school and ran it for 8 years. For what seems forever, I have run a private studio for piano/voice lessons and math/language arts tutoring. I also enjoy singing and playing keyboard/percussion with an eclectic band called Wicked Olde.
